Administering Peripheral Blood Lymphocytes Transduced With a Murine T-Cell Receptor Recognizing...

Pancreatic CancerGastric Cancer3 more

Background: A new cancer therapy involves taking white blood cells from a person, growing them in the lab, genetically modifying them, then giving them back to the person. This therapy is called gene transfer using anti-KRAS G12V mTCR cells. Objective: To see if anti-KRAS G12 V mTCR cells are safe and can shrink tumors. Eligibility: Adults at least 18 years old with cancer that has the KRAS G12V molecule on the surface of tumors. Design: In another protocol, participants will: Be screened Have cells harvested and grown Have leukapheresis In this protocol, participants will have the procedures below. Participants will be admitted to the hospital. Over 5 days, participants will get 2 chemotherapy medicines as an infusion via catheter in the upper chest. A few days later, participants will get the anti-KRAS G12V mTCR cells via catheter. For up to 3 days, participants will get a drug to make the cells active. A day after getting the cells, participants will get a drug to increase their white blood cell count. This will be a shot or injection under the skin. Participants will recover in the hospital for 1-2 weeks. They will have lab and blood tests. Participants will take an antibiotic for at least 6 months. Participants will have visits every few months for 2 years, and then as determined by their doctor. Visits will be 1-2 days. They will include lab tests, imaging studies, and physical exam. Some visits may include leukapheresis or blood drawn. Participants will have blood collected over several years.

EUS-guided RFA for Solid Abdominal Neoplasms

Digestive System Neoplasms

Radiofrequency ablation has been used for treatment of solid neoplasms of the liver, lung, kidney and adrenal. Recently, EUS-guided RFA has become available and the device allows EUS-guided treatment of solid abdominal neoplasms. The procedure has been shown to be feasible in the porcine pancreas and was used to treat small groups of patients that are not suitable for surgery suffering from pancreatic cancers. The aim of the current study is to perform a multi-center prospective study on EUS-guided radiofrequency ablation (RFA) of solid abdominal neoplasms. The hypothesis is that EUS-guided RFA is safe, feasible and effective for treating solid abdominal neoplasms.

A Study Evaluating Different Doses of BI 765049 When Given Alone and When Given With Ezabenlimab...

Colorectal NeoplasmsCarcinoma6 more

This study is open to adults with advanced solid tumors whose previous cancer treatment was not successful. People can participate if their tumor has the B7-H6 marker or if they have colorectal cancer. The study tests 2 medicines called BI 765049 and ezabenlimab (BI 754091). Both medicines may help the immune system fight cancer. The purpose of this study is to find out the highest dose of BI 765049 alone and in combination with ezabenlimab the participants can tolerate. In this study, BI 765049 is given to people for the first time. Participants can stay in the study for up to 3 years, if they benefit from treatment and can tolerate it. During this time, they get BI 765049 alone or in combination with ezabenlimab as infusion into a vein every 3 weeks. The doctors check the health of the participants and note any health problems that could have been caused by BI 765049 or ezabenlimab. The doctors also regularly monitor the size of the tumor.

FOLFIRINOX vs FLOT Chemotherapy for Resectable Gastric or Esophagogastric Junction Adenocarcinoma...

Stomach NeoplasmsGastrointestinal Neoplasms4 more

Patients with resectable adenocarcinoma of the stomach or the esophagogastric junction (II-III type by Siewert) without previous therapy will be treated with one of two chemotherapy combinations before and after surgery. One half of the patients gets 5-Fluorouracil (5-FU), Leucovorin, Oxaliplatin and Docetaxel (FLOT), the others 5-Fluorouracil (5-FU), Leucovorin, Oxaliplatin and Irinotecan (FOLFIRINOX). Main objective of the study is median overall survival.
